Top 5 Communication Apps Performance in France Q3 2021
Discover the performance trends of the top 5 communication apps in France during Q3 2021, including weekly downloads, revenue, and active users.
In Q3 2021, the top 5 communication apps in France displayed diverse trends in terms of weekly downloads, revenue, and active users. Data from Sensor Tower provides a comprehensive view of their performance on a unified platform.
Azar: Video Chat & Meet People saw its weekly revenue fluctuate between approximately $83K and $102K, peaking in late June and early July. Weekly downloads for the app ranged from 17K to 22K, with a noticeable increase in early August. Active users remained relatively stable, hovering around 170K to 185K.
Onoff experienced a steady weekly revenue flow, varying from around $69K to $87K, with a peak in mid-September. Downloads showed a slight decline over the quarter, starting at 5.7K and ending at 5.2K. Active users remained consistent, averaging around 30K.
For Discord - Talk, Play, Hang Out, weekly revenue ranged from approximately $36K to $47K, with a peak in mid-September. Weekly downloads were strong, fluctuating between 49K and 60K, and active users remained robust, consistently exceeding 4M.
Libon: Calls and Recharge had a weekly revenue range of $47K to $64K, with a peak in mid-July. Downloads varied slightly, with numbers ranging from 2.1K to 2.7K. Active users were stable, maintaining around 9K to 10K throughout the quarter.
Lastly, Cafe - Live video chat displayed modest weekly revenue, ranging from $3.3K to $5.9K. Downloads were low but stable, with figures between 411 and 1.2K. Active users fluctuated, starting at 1.2K and decreasing to around 973 by the end of the quarter.
